Autodesk 'Favorable' Heading Into Earnings, UBS Says

Loading...
Loading...
In a report published Tuesday, analysts at UBS maintained their Buy rating on
Autodesk, Inc.ADSK
. The price target was maintained at $74. The company's stock has declined 4 percent year-to-date, driven by macro and other concerns. The analysts believe these concerns are overdone, given that "industry peers had a good start to CY15 except for some of the higher-end vendors in the manufacturing space. FX headwind was a common theme, though ADSK has an effective 4-quarter rolling FX hedging strategy and rates appear to be stabilizing recently." UBS expressed its optimism regarding the steady progress Autodesk has been making in transitioning its business model to subscriptions. The company has also continued to make market share gains. The stock's valuation is attractive at present. "Although recent macro-economic headwinds have led to inconsistent execution and slower growth, a positive dynamic has been the company's decision to accelerate its transition to a recurring revenue model, including expanded product rental options," the analysts said. Autodesk guided to revenue and EPS for FQ1 in-line with the estimates and the consensus.
